The East Central Community College Alumni Association will host its 16th Annual Warrior Golf Classic Thursday, May 11, at the Dancing Rabbit Golf Club in Choctaw.

All proceeds from the tournament again will support the scholarship program at the college. Last year’s tournament raised more than $10,100 for the scholarship program.

The four-person scramble will be played on The Azaleas course at Dancing Rabbit located in the Pearl River Resort.

Registration will begin at 8 a.m. at the Club House, and the tournament will begin at 9 a.m. with a shotgun start. The Warrior Golf Classic will conclude with a buffet lunch and awards ceremony around 2:30 p.m.

“We had a record number of teams for last year’s Warrior Golf Classic, and we hope to grow the tournament even more this year,” said David LeBlanc, ECCC’s director of alumni relations and the foundation. “It’s a great tournament on a fantastic golf course with many amenities, and all proceeds provide financial assistance to East Central students.”
